Output 7923384af1396aeb1d50520e4f6ce52fa23d3400693cab476bd805c2ca22c224:5

value
25803858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7af31e5312b4f849117388be5c844a9f4a1907b OP_EQUALVERIFY OP_CHECKSIG
address
1Padn8yEsw7BpkY8o4Mtv3MVvz5jSPsGuG
transaction
7923384af1396aeb1d50520e4f6ce52fa23d3400693cab476bd805c2ca22c224
spent
true